Explanation:

Brief Explanations
  1. The assassination of Archduke Franz Ferdinand in 1914 triggered WWI. Option a has the wrong name, b is Stalin (not related to WWI start), d is incorrect. So c is correct.
  2. After the assassination, Austria - Hungary first sought Germany's support (the "blank check") in case Russia intervened. Declaring war (a) was later, the ultimatum to Serbia (c) came after seeking German support, and the Black Hand (d) was the group, not the target of an ultimatum. So b is correct.
  3. Austria - Hungary declared war on Serbia first, starting WWI. America (b) joined later, Germany (c) and Russia (d) declared war after Austria - Hungary. So a is correct.
  4. Germany invaded Belgium (a neutral country) first, starting the invasion chain. Austria - Hungary (a) attacked Serbia, but Germany's invasion of Belgium was a key invasion of another country. Russia (c) and France (d) were defending or mobilizing. So b is correct.
  5. The Allied Powers at the start included England, France, Russia, and Japan. The Ottoman Empire (a) was Central, Germany/Austria - Hungary (c) were Central, and Germany (d) was Central. So b is correct.
  6. The Central Powers at the start were Germany, Austria - Hungary, and the Ottoman Empire. The other options (a, b, d) include Allied nations. So c is correct.
